P.R.I.D.E.

Parents Reducing Incidents of Driver Error

P.R.I.D.E. offers a FREE 2-hour course designed to help parents and new teen drivers, ages 14 to 16, learn how to manage the 40 hours of supervised practice driving time required by law.  P.R.I.D.E. addresses driver attitude, knowledge and behavior, rather than hands-on driver skills. It is designed to complement existing driver's education programs.  The P.R.I.D.E. curriculum includes teen driving facts and statistics, crash dynamics, the Graduated Driver's Licensing (GDL) process and Georgia's teenage driving law.
